I was going through the same problem you were when i first started out. Practice. Pick a simple song and practice singing. I think once you can really nail a song, you can devote more effort to singing and not have to worry about what you are playing. It'll become second nature. Also maybe try keeping a rhythm by stomping your foot, dave grohl style. Try Hide your love away or Elderly woman--easy to learn, you'll be able to do them in ur sleep. Then sing w/ the chord changes. Hope this helps.0

i think its one of those things that you either find it comes to you naturally, or you need to work on it....
i generally just always sing, am always singing....sing sing sing, so i tend to find it easy enough, but i suggest you learn the song really really well, then start to hum along to it, gradually putting in a line here, a line there and soon you'll be able to sing and play im sure.
